π Activity 1: Capstone Portfolio Submission & Reflection (15 mins)
Audit your portfolio against the NZQA criteria one at a time, and for each, point at the exact page and paragraph that satisfies it. Anything you cannot point at is missing, no matter how sure you are that you did it. Fix the three biggest gaps before you present.

π§ Kaiako Planning Notes & NCEA Alignment
NCEA Level 1 Digital Technologies Alignment (6 Credits Internal):
- Technological Practice: Undertake development to make a conceptual design for an outcome.
- Differentiation & Scaffolding: Provide physical component samples and sentence frames for stakeholder interviews and justification writing.
- Extension (Excellence): Challenge students to conduct a full Life Cycle Assessment (LCA) tracing raw material extraction through to end-of-life e-waste processing.
- Te Ao MΔori Integration: Ground material choice in traditional ecological knowledge (mΔtauranga taiao) regarding resource extraction and seasonal renewal.
